Operation: Dig Dug About Rainier Beach Urban Farm & Wetlands: Rainier Beach Urban Farm & Wetlands (RBUFW) was formerly a Seattle Parks nursery. The City of Seattle contracted with Seattle Tilth and the Friends of Rainier Beach Urban Farm & Wetlands in 2011 to coordinate the transformation of the site into a community education center that supports a natural wetlands and organic food production. At RBUFW in 2014, Seattle Tilth engaged more than 500 volunteers, offered more than 17,000 hours of educational programs reaching 3,500 community members, and grew 10,000 pounds of food that was distributed to the community and sold as part of our social enterprise. About Seattle Tilth: Founded in 1978, Seattle Tilth is a nationally recognized nonprofit educational organization that inspires and educates people to safeguard our natural resources while building an equitable and sustainable local food system. We offer classes and hands-on training in sustainable urban agriculture and environmental stewardship for all ages. Learn more at www.seattletilth.org. What to Expect: Service days on the farm are fun, family-friendly events! Opportunities for work and learning for your group include both organic farm production and ecological restoration of the wetlands. Sample farm tasks include preparing planting beds, planting, watering, weeding, harvesting, and composting, as well as caring for the small livestock on the farm – chickens, bees, fish, and red wiggler worms. Wetland work includes removing invasive weeds, planting wetland trees and shrubs and sheet mulching to protect them.
